本节课主要针对数据库原理进行加深理解、实践能力、总结提高三个方向的讲解,帮助同学们对这门课有更加深刻的认知。 01课前准备 课前预习一般为5分钟左右的音频,主要介绍学习本章节前如何快速有效的预习以及学习经验方法(课前需要准备什么,预习需要重点注意哪几部分,...
2教学任务(rn wu)(学习任务(rn wu):能够进行简单能够进行简单(jindn)(jindn)的数的数据库设计据库设计打好坚实打好坚实(jinsh)(jinsh)的基的基础础掌握数据库系统掌握数据库系统基本概念基本概念、基本原理基本原理熟练掌握熟练掌握SQLSQL说大纲说大纲第2页/共112页第二页,共113页。3笔试笔试(bsh)(bsh)...
为了保证数据库的一致性和完整性,在逻辑设计的时候往往会设计过多的表间关联,尽可能的降低数据的冗余。(例如用户表的地区,我们可以把地区另外存放到一个地区表中)如果数据冗余低,数据的完整性容易得到保证,提高了数据吞吐速度,保证了数据的完整性,清楚地表达数据元素之间的关系。而对于多表之间的关联查询(尤其是大数...
在软件开发过程中,设计数据库模型是一个非常重要的步骤。通常情况下,我们会通过手动创建表和字段的方式来设计数据库模型。但是,随着业务复杂度的提高,手动创建数据库模型的效率将会逐渐降低。当我们需要设计上百张表的时候,手动编写DDL语句就会变得非常繁琐。因此,自动化生成数据库模型图的需求越来越高。
火山引擎是字节跳动旗下的云服务平台,将字节跳动快速发展过程中积累的增长方法、技术能力和应用工具开放给外部企业,提供云基础、视频与内容分发、数智平台VeDI、人工智能、开发与运维等服务,帮助企业在数字化升级中实现持续增长。本页核心内容:sql数据库系统框架图
MSSQL工作原理 我们做管理软件的,主要核心就在数据存储管理上。所以数据库设计是我们的重中之重。为了让我们的管理软件能够稳定、可扩展、性能优秀、可跟踪排错、可升级部署、可插件运行,我们往往研发自己的管理软件开发平台。我们总是希望去学习别人的开发平台(如用友或金蝶或SAP),但我们却总是感叹管理软件业务处理细...
对二级查询中查询到的每个主键,都需要回到聚集索引中在查询数据行。 比如开发人员最喜爱得 select * ... 就经常会回表 回表理解:select * 导致业务覆盖不到索引,那么优化器决策后很可能就不走辅助索引了,因为辅助索引上拿到的 key 太多了,随机回表开销太大,还不如走聚...
句创建并管理数据 库、数据表 云南大学软件学院 实验报告 课程: 数据库原理与实用技术实验学期:2012-2013学年第二学期 实验 、实验目的 (1) (2) (3) (4) 二、实验内容 1 记录创建数据库的 CQLQuarytql d4 7\lanawa LIC£ « < L «! Ex V —P・MwE.1I1P X J、一数t居库on i ...
报错注入的原理 为了弄清报错注入的原理,首先先创建了一个名为sqli的数据库,然后建表插入数据: mysql> create database sqli; mysql> create table user ( id int(11) not null auto_increment primary key, name varchar(20) not null, pass varchar(32) not null ...
1.4 数据模型 1.4.1 数据模型的组成 1.4.2 数据模型的分类 1.5 数据库的分类 1.5.1 关系数据库 1.5.2 非关系数据库 1.5.3 关系数据库与非关系数据库的区别 1.6 常见的关系数据库 1.6.1 Access数据库 1.6.2 MySQL数据库 1.6.3 Oracle数据库 1.6.4 SQL Server数据库 本章小结 习题...